Style over sound
These are designed to be looked at rather than heard. With a sufficient powerful power supply - one's not included, just a USB C cable?! - the sound is OK if you're playing dance music. It's not bad if you're playing something less bassy (that is an improvement on some Creative headphones!) but it's nowhere near what you could get by paying less for some bookcase Bluetooth speakers or some old passive speakers plus a Bluetooth amp. Not that these are designed to be put on a bookcase: the angle of the two side speakers is very definitely pointed upwards. These are wanting to be on the floor if you're sitting down a couple of metres away, or perhaps towards the back of a desk at the level of the keyboard. The amplifier in these is in the right hand one of the pair. This is combined with having a fairly short and very definitely fixed cable to the left hand one - forget having them more than a metre apart - and an equally fixed but slightly longer one to the sub-woofer. "My sub-woofer goes up to three..." The sub-woofer has three speakers: one fairly small powered one facing forwards and two smaller passive ones to the sides. One of the first things you learn when doing sound in school physics is that humans are not good at telling which direction low frequency sound is coming from. Having three speakers (OK, one plus two echos) pointing in different directions for the low notes is just silly and having them be small ones limits just what they can do on those low notes... but hey, it looks neat, doesn't it? Also in the 'there to be looked at, not listened to' category are the lights on the main two. These have a number of patterns you can cycle through, but the one that's supposed to be the equivalent of a sound meter is terrible. Some of the others aren't bad, but you can also turn them off, fortunately. As with much Creative kit, you can use their app to tweak stuff. As with much Creative kit when it's new, you can't tweak much - these could really use an EQ control so you can adjust the sound, but you can only play with the lights. That may or may not change. At the price point - currently £115 or so with the silly tickbox 'voucher' - there is no excuse for not having any Bluetooth codecs beyond the basic SBC.

These might not be for audiophiles but for the average desktop user these are going to sound amazing. The little subwoofer is mighty but really benefits from being placed next to a hard surface. I put mine behind my monitor in a corner and it amplifies the bass quite a bit. The speakers themselves are quite a bit larger than my Pebble V2s and feel weighty. The RGB lighting is a bit of a gimmick but it looks nice and I was able to make it match my setup. They lack passive radiators which most of the other pebble speakers have, but it's not needed due to the sub. For desktop computer speakers they really do sound great and can get uncomfortably loud with a 30W PD adapter. I like them very much for gaming or watching TV shows on my computer. Another huge bonus for me is connecting them to my computer with USB so I don't have to use the motherboard sound card. It's also absolutely worth downloading the Creative desktop app if you use the speakers with USB as it gives you a full equalizer and access to a few other audio filtering features that improved my experience, and allowed me to customize the lighting to match my setup. There are a few downsides though: - You need a 30W PD adapter to get the most out of these speakers, but one is *not* included for the price. It is forgivable for the cheaper Pebble speakers but these flagship models really should have included what is basically an essential accessory. - They are a bit expensive. Wait for a sale if you can. - Cables everywhere. It was a bit of work to get this setup looking clean and tidy under my new screen. If you're a fan of the Pebble series and in need of a compact speaker setup, these are worth considering. If they included a PD adapter and dropped the price 20%, it would be a no-brainer. Edit: Had these a year now and upgrading my rating to 5 stars. I've purchased several other inexpensive computer speakers with subwoofer to try with my other computer and nothing in this price range come close to the levels of deep bass this little set can produce. It might be limited in overall power - Logitech and Edifier speakers at this price point will probably be better for bigger rooms, but for a compact set that can still produce ~45Hz at reasonable volume levels, these are the king.
